Nancy Kay (Beeler) Kerby

January 24, 1943 – October 18, 2023

Nancy Kay (Beeler) Kerby, 80 of Lancaster, Missouri passed away on Wednesday, October 18, 2023 at her daughter's home in rural Lancaster, Missouri.

The daughter of Lowell Edmond and Authrine (Burgher) Beeler, she was born on January 24, 1943 in Kirksville, Missouri.  She attended and graduated from the Lancaster High School in Lancaster, Missouri. After high school, she attended and graduated from flight attendant school. She was united in marriage on January 18, 1969 to Stanley Kerby and to this union two daughters were born, April and Ashley.

Survivors include her children, April Kerby of Lancaster, Missouri and Ashley Aeschliman and husband, Nick of Lancaster, Missouri; 6 grandchildren, Shayla Kerby of Lancaster, Missouri, Kayla Schafer and husband, Nathan of Poplar Bluff, Missouri, Chrissy Kerby of Queen City, Missouri, Shaelyn Scoon of Lancaster, Missouri, Paige  and Levi Aeschliman of Corning, Iowa and Newt Aeschliman of Lancaster, Missouri; 6 great grandchildren, Lyrika, Zeplyn and Knox Kerby of Lancaster, Missouri and Caisley, Joshua and Milo Schafer of Poplar Bluff, Missouri; 1 uncle, Charles Beeler of Lancaster, Missouri who had a special nickname for Nancy, "Junebug"; 1 aunt, Violet Smoot of Kansas; 1 sister-in-law, Nancy Beeler of Indiana; 3 nieces and 2 nephews, many cousins, other family members and many good friends.

Nancy is preceded in death by her parents; 1 brother, James Beeler and 1 aunt, Gretchen Adkins.

Nancy was best known as "Nan" or "Nana" by her family and those who were close to her. She loved her dogs and loved doing things for her family. She would help them any time, day or night. She will be greatly missed by all.
